πŸ₯« Most-Needed Donations

Gravesham Foodbank is currently in need of:
β€’ Tinned Goods: Peas, Fruit, Veg, Cold Meat
β€’ Hearty Meals: Ravioli, Beans & Sausages, Meat Pies
β€’ Cupboard Staples: Cous Cous, Pasta β€˜n’ Sauce, Crackers
β€’ Tinned Fish (No Anchovies)
β€’ Essentials & Treats: Mash Packets, Chocolate Spread, Biscuits, Crisps (multi-packs), Sweets
β€’ Drinks & Condiments: Bottled Squash, Ketchup, Mayo, Salad Cream
β€’ Toiletries & Cleaning: Anti-bac Wipes, Conditioner, Bio & Non-Bio Washing Tabs
